Key Factors That Drive FeV80 Pricing

The price of ferro vanadium FeV80 is determined by a combination of raw material, quality, logistics, volume and market conditions. Understanding these drivers helps procurement teams separate justified price movements from short-term noise and time their purchases more effectively.

How It Affects FeV80 Cost
The price of vanadium pentoxide (V2O5) directly affects FeV80 cost because V2O5 is the main vanadium source used in ferrovanadium production.
Higher-purity FeV80 with tight chemistry improves steel properties; stricter specifications typically command a premium.
Freight, customs clearance and lead time all affect the total landed cost of each shipment.
Larger orders often result in lower per-ton pricing through scale and production efficiency.
Demand for high-strength and specialty steels influences vanadium consumption and market pricing.

How FeV80 Quality Affects Cost and Value

A low price is only attractive if the material performs. Consistent chemical composition, verified vanadium, carbon, sulfur, silicon and iron levels, and batch traceability protect the steel plant from off-specification heats and rework costs. Buyers should ask for a Certificate of Analysis (COA) for each shipment, and where the application is critical, arrange third-party inspection as an independent verification step. For European and U.S. buyers, complete documentation supporting regulatory compliance should be treated as part of the quoted value, not as an optional extra.

Cost Efficiency Through Volume and Long-Term Agreements

Steel plants can reduce per-ton cost through volume negotiation and supply stability. Negotiating volume discounts lowers the unit price of larger orders, while long-term supply contracts guarantee material availability and stabilize pricing against short-term market swings. Delivery scheduling also matters: just-in-time supply reduces storage cost and limits exposure to price volatility, provided the supplier can commit to reliable lead times. Flexible packaging, such as 25 kg bags or 1 MT jumbo bags, allows plants to match logistics to their actual consumption pattern.

Even without external price subscriptions, a steel plant can improve its purchasing position by tracking internal pricing trends and production demand, aligning purchase timing with the cost fluctuations of raw vanadium materials, and planning orders around seasonal steel demand and maintenance schedules. When several buyers act on the same trend signals, market tightness can develop quickly; a documented internal consumption history gives procurement a defensible basis for forward orders.

An effective FeV80 sourcing process combines price awareness with quality assurance. First, understand internal cost drivers and actual vanadium usage per ton of steel. Second, select a supplier who offers traceable quality and consistent supply, with COA and inspection options. Third, use bulk orders or long-term agreements to improve pricing. Fourth, coordinate logistics so that freight, customs and inventory cost are minimized. Applying these steps in sequence allows a steel plant to secure competitive FeV80 pricing without compromising quality or delivery reliability.

Q1: What is the largest cost component in FeV80 pricing?

A: Vanadium pentoxide (V2O5) is typically the dominant cost component, because it is the primary vanadium-bearing raw material consumed in ferrovanadium production.

Q2: Does higher FeV80 purity always cost more?

A: Not always, but stricter chemistry control usually requires better process control and more selective raw materials, which generally supports a price premium over standard grades.

Q3: How can a steel plant verify FeV80 quality on receipt?

A: By reviewing the Certificate of Analysis against the agreed specification, and by arranging independent third-party inspection or in-house sampling for critical parameters such as vanadium, carbon and sulfur.

Q4: Are long-term supply contracts better than spot purchases?

A: Long-term contracts improve price stability and supply security, while spot purchases offer flexibility; many plants combine both to balance risk.

Q5: Why do FeV80 quotes vary by destination?

A: Freight, customs duties and documentation requirements differ by destination, so quotes are typically compared on a landed cost basis rather than on the unit price alone.
